Every transaction online depends on two foundational technologies working seamlessly together: DNS and SSL/TLS. For many organizations, however, the way these systems are managed is anything but seamless. DNS may be hosted with one provider, certificates handled by another, and monitoring tools scattered across a half-dozen platforms.
This fragmentation creates risk, slows down certificate issuance, complicates renewals, and adds unnecessary operational overhead. The more providers you juggle, the harder it becomes to deliver a consistent, secure, high-performance experience to your users.
However, by bringing DNS, DNSSEC, monitoring, failover, and automation together, organizations can simplify certificate management, strengthen trust, and increase uptime. They can also cut down their IT team’s workload.
It all hinges on consolidating DNS and certificate workflows under a single, reliable platform.
What is DNS?
The Domain Name System (DNS) is the foundational directory of the internet. When a user types a website URL into a browser, DNS translates that human-readable domain name into the numerical IP address that servers use to route traffic. Without DNS, browsers wouldn’t know where websites live, applications couldn’t communicate, and online services would grind to a halt.
Modern organizations manage hundreds, sometimes thousands, of DNS records, especially as digital environments expand.
What is Secure Sockets Layer/Transport Layer Security (SSL/TLS)?
SSL/TLS is the protocol that encrypts communication between a user’s browser and a web server. It ensures that sensitive information — like logins, payment details, personal data — cannot be intercepted or tampered with in transit.
A note about vocabulary: “SSL” is still widely used as shorthand for SSL/TLS. However, the modern, secure version is TLS. TLS certificates validate that a website is authentic and ensure visitors connect securely, which is why browsers flag unencrypted websites as unsafe.
How Do DNS and SSL/TLS Work Together To Secure Online Experiences?
DNS and SSL/TLS operate at different layers of the internet stack, but they work hand-in-hand to build a secure and trustworthy online presence.
- Certificate Authorities (CAs) issue SSL certificates: Before a website can use HTTPS, it needs an SSL/TLS certificate issued by a trusted Certificate Authority (CA). The CA verifies that the requester actually owns the domain before issuing the certificate.
- DNS records indicate policy: A DNS CAA record (Certificate Authority Authorization) specifies which certificate authorities (CAs) are permitted to issue SSL/TLS certificates for a domain. This prevents unauthorized CAs from issuing certificates for the domain, and also acts as a safeguard against accidental certificate issuance.
- DNS records prove domain ownership: One of the most common verification methods requires DNS changes. Organizations often need to add TXT or CNAME records to prove domain ownership. If DNS is slow, scattered across multiple providers, or poorly maintained, certificate validation becomes harder and slower.
- DNS propagation can affect SSL readiness: DNS changes take time to propagate around the internet. Until DNS updates reach all resolvers globally, certificate issuance or renewal may stall. This is why efficient, reliable DNS management is essential to keeping certificates functioning and avoiding browser warnings.
How Does DNSSEC Help SSL/TLS?
Domain name security extension (DNSSEC) is a set of protocols created by the Internet Engineering Task Force (IEFT). Its purpose is to provide an additional layer of security during the DNS lookup process. It does this by adding cryptographic signatures to DNS records, proving that the responses users receive are authentic and haven’t been altered.
While SSL/TLS protects the communication between browsers and servers, DNSSEC protects the integrity of the DNS lookup itself. Together, they close critical security gaps:
- DNSSEC prevents DNS spoofing and cache poisoning
- SSL/TLS protects data in transit
- Both work together to build a verifiable chain of trust from lookup to connection; the registrar’s role is to create the cryptographic information that securely links a domain to its parent top level domain (TLD).
Organizations that use DNSSEC dramatically reduce the risk of traffic hijacking and certificate attacks, especially when paired with a reliable DNS provider.
Practical Steps: Configuring DNS for SSL Implementation
To align DNS and SSL you’ll need to configure your DNS. Custom DNS configurations give you more granular control over security and performance, although it is important to make sure you’ve configured your DNS correctly.
In this case, there are a few steps you’ll need to take:
- Generate a Certificate Signing Request (CSR): The CSR is created on your server and contains your domain name, organization details, and your public key. This is what the CA uses to generate your SSL certificate.
- Update your DNS records for certificate activation: Most CAs require DNS verification. This may include:
- Adding TXT records for domain validation
- Creating a CNAME record pointing to a verification URL
- Ensuring A/AAAA records point to the correct server before activation
- Certificate binding: Once issued, the certificate must be installed and bound to the correct domain and ports on your web server. A mismatched or incorrectly-bound certificate triggers browser warnings.
- Manage custom domains and nameservers for SSL: When custom domains or vanity nameservers are in use, DNS must be clean, accurate, and trustworthy. Any outdated records, incorrect IPs, or missing hostnames can disrupt certificate issuance or renewal.
Troubleshooting common DNS and SSL issues
Even with the right certificate and a solid DNS configuration, issues can surface, especially in environments where DNS is fragmented across multiple providers or where certificates are manually maintained. Understanding the most common failure points helps teams diagnose problems quickly and prevent outages or browser warnings.
Diagnosing certificate mismatch errors
Certificate mismatch errors occur when the domain requested by a browser doesn’t align with the domain listed on the SSL/TLS certificate. When this happens, browsers display security warnings that immediately erode user trust or and block access.
Common causes include:
- Incorrect A/AAAA records
- Old CNAME records pointing to the wrong target
- Multiple sites sharing an IP without proper SNI configuration
Debugging DNS propagation delays
DNS propagation delays occur when DNS changes, such as TXT records for certificate validation, haven’t been updated across global resolvers. These delays can stall certificate issuance, prevent renewals, cause downtime, and create inconsistent user experiences.
Slow propagation often results from:
- Long TTL values
- Hosting DNS on low-performance or globally limited providers
- Fragmented DNS architecture spread across multiple vendors
Utilizing SSL checkers and DNS lookup tools
Online diagnostics tools can validate certificates, check expiration dates, verify SANs, and inspect DNS configurations. Pair these with authoritative DNS monitoring to ensure continuous reliability.
Useful actions include:
- Running SSL checkers to inspect certificate details
- Using DNS lookup tools to verify that authoritative DNS is correct
- Leaning on DNS monitoring for real-time visibility
How to manage DNS and SSL together
Managing DNS and SSL/TLS in a coordinated, streamlined way is essential for maintaining uptime, ensuring continuous certificate trust, and avoiding the operational headaches that come with scattered DNS providers and manual certificate processes.
Below are some best practices that help organizations unify their approach and reduce risk:
- Enable DNSSEC: This protects your DNS layer from tampering and ensures certificates point to the correct, trusted endpoints.
- Have a redundant DNS infrastructure: Redundancy eliminates single points of failure. Multi-cloud DNS, multiple PoPs, and anycast routing keep DNS online, even during outages.
- Monitor and audit DNS activity: Continuous visibility helps identify misconfigurations, unauthorized changes, or DNS hijacking attempts.
- Use short TTLs for changes: Lower TTLs allow rapid certificate validation and smoother certificate renewals, which are critical during migrations or CA transitions.
- Implement automatic or fast DNS failover and traffic routing: Failover ensures that if one endpoint becomes unreachable, traffic instantly shifts to a healthy server, protecting both uptime and certificate accessibility.
- Use templates & automation: Templates and automated record deployment eliminate manual errors and ensure consistency across domains and subdomains.
- Regularly audit DNS and clean up old or unused records: Old entries clutter DNS, cause conflicts, and disrupt SSL workflows. A clean DNS zone is easier to manage and safer to secure.
Why managing DNS and SSL together matters
Managing DNS and SSL/TLS across multiple vendors introduces unnecessary complexity: mismatched configurations, delayed propagation, slow validation, fragmented monitoring, and inconsistent uptime guarantees.
A consolidated DNS platform eliminates these problems. With centralized controls, built-in security features, automation, and globally resilient infrastructure, teams can streamline certificate management while improving reliability and reducing operational work.
This is where DNS Made Easy excels; it’s an integrated, high-performance DNS platform that simplifies management, increases trust, and keeps services online no matter what.
Ready to make DNS and SSL management effortless? Explore DNS Made Easy’s platform and see how much simpler life can be.